Which type of massage is right for me?

The right massage depends on your needs. If you’re looking for relaxation and stress relief, a Rebalance massage might be best. For muscle tension or pain relief, deep tissue or sports massage may be more suitable. If you have deeper issues, injuries, or chronic pain, we recommend booking with an Elite or Master therapist for specialized care. If you’re unsure, our therapists can recommend the right treatment based on your goals.

A Rebalance massage is our signature treatment, designed to restore harmony between body and mind. It combines deep tissue techniques, myofascial release, and intuitive touch to relieve tension, improve mobility, and support emotional well-being.

A deep tissue massage targets deeper layers of muscle and fascia to release chronic tension, break down adhesions, and improve mobility. It’s ideal for those with persistent pain, muscle tightness, or recovery from injuries. While it can be intense, our therapists adjust pressure to your comfort level.

A sports massage is beneficial before or after physical activity, helping to prevent injuries, improve performance, and speed up recovery. It’s also useful for treating existing sports-related injuries or chronic muscular imbalances.

Holistic massage focuses on treating the whole person—body, mind, and spirit—rather than just physical symptoms. It combines technical massage techniques with mindfulness, breathwork, and energy balancing to support overall well-being.

We generally recommend waiting 24 hours before intense exercise, especially after deep tissue or sports massage, as your muscles need time to recover. Light movement, like walking or stretching, is fine and can help maintain the benefits.

The frequency of massage depends on your goals. For general wellness, once a month is ideal. If you’re dealing with chronic pain, stress, or recovery from an injury, weekly or biweekly sessions may be more beneficial. Your therapist can create a personalized plan for you.

Your therapist will discuss your needs, concerns, and any medical conditions before beginning the session. You’ll be guided on how to lie on the massage table and draped for privacy. The treatment will be adjusted to your comfort level, and you’re encouraged to communicate any preferences.
